*CALL TO WORSHIP

One:     It is still Christmas.

All:      Joy is still loose in the world,

One:     Love is lodged in hearts,

All:      and peace is still our fervent hope.

One:     It is still Christmas,

All:      Though the presents are all unwrapped,

One:     The batteries have run down,

All:      And family members have returned home.

One:     It is still Christmas,

All:      For God begins anew,

One:     Giving us a baby to care for

All:      And calling us to live with tender compassion, gentle care and overflowing love.

UNISON PRAYER OF CONFESSION

 

Almighty God, your love and power transform death into life, despair into hope, lifeless stumps into tender shoots and a tiny baby into the Prince of Peace. In the hearing of your Word and the repenting of our sins, transform the hardness of our hearts into lives of receptivity, following the Holy One who came to baptize us with the Holy Spirit and fire, Jesus Christ, our Lord.  Amen.
